Common Causes of a Turn Signal That Won’t Turn Off
A turn signal that fails to deactivate can be traced to several underlying issues within the vehicle’s electrical or mechanical systems. Understanding these causes can help diagnose and fix the problem efficiently.
One of the most frequent causes is a faulty turn signal switch. This switch, located on the steering column, is responsible for activating and deactivating the signals. Over time, the contacts inside the switch can wear out or become stuck, causing the signal to remain on even after the lever is returned to its neutral position.
Another common issue is a malfunctioning turn signal relay. The relay acts as a timed on/off controller for the blinking function. If the relay becomes stuck in the “on” position, the turn signal may continue to flash indefinitely.
Problems with the cancelling cam or mechanism can also cause the signal to remain active. This mechanical component interacts with the steering wheel and the signal switch, automatically turning the signal off once the wheel is returned to center after a turn. If the cam is broken or misaligned, the signal won’t cancel as intended.
Electrical faults, such as damaged wiring or poor grounding, can cause irregular signal behavior. Corroded connectors or frayed wires may create unintended circuits that keep the turn signal illuminated.
Lastly, some vehicles with advanced electronic systems may experience issues related to the Body Control Module (BCM) or other computer-controlled components that manage turn signals.
Diagnosing the Turn Signal Problem
Proper diagnosis is essential for fixing a turn signal that won’t turn off. This involves a systematic approach to isolate the cause:
- Check the turn signal lever: Observe if the lever physically returns to its neutral position after a turn. If it sticks or does not move freely, the switch mechanism may need inspection.
- Test the turn signal relay: Listen for clicking sounds when activating the signal. A relay stuck in the “on” position may fail to click off.
- Inspect the cancelling cam: Access the steering column cover to examine the cam’s condition and alignment.
- Examine wiring and connectors: Look for signs of corrosion, damage, or loose connections especially near the fuse box and steering column.
- Scan for error codes: Use an OBD-II scanner to detect any BCM or related system faults that might be affecting turn signal operation.
Troubleshooting Steps and Repairs
Once the cause is identified, targeted repairs can be made. Below are general troubleshooting and repair steps for common causes:
- Turn Signal Switch Replacement: If the switch is worn or damaged, replacing it often resolves the issue. This typically involves removing the steering column covers and disconnecting electrical connectors.
- Turn Signal Relay Replacement: Swap out the relay with a new one, ensuring compatibility with your vehicle’s make and model.
- Adjust or Replace Cancelling Cam: Realign the cam if it is out of position or replace it if broken. This requires careful disassembly of the steering column.
- Repair Wiring and Grounds: Clean corroded connectors, repair damaged wires, and ensure all ground points are secure.
- Reset or Reprogram BCM: In vehicles with electronic modules, clearing fault codes or updating software may be necessary. This should be done with appropriate diagnostic tools.
Turn Signal System Components and Their Functions
Understanding the key components helps clarify their roles in turn signal operation and why malfunction in each can cause the signal to stay on.
| Component | Function | Common Issues |
|---|---|---|
| Turn Signal Switch | Controls activation and deactivation of turn signals via the lever | Worn contacts, mechanical sticking, internal damage |
| Turn Signal Relay | Regulates the blinking on/off timing of the turn signals | Relay stuck closed, electrical failure |
| Cancelling Cam | Automatically turns off the signal after a turn based on steering wheel position | Broken cam, misalignment, worn components |
| Wiring and Connectors | Transmit electrical signals between switch, relay, and lights | Corrosion, breaks, poor grounding |
| Body Control Module (BCM) | Manages electronic functions including turn signal operation in modern vehicles | Software glitches, sensor faults, communication errors |

Why does my turn signal stay on and not turn off?
A malfunctioning turn signal switch, a stuck relay, or electrical issues such as a short circuit can cause the turn signal to remain active. Mechanical wear or debris inside the switch assembly may also prevent it from disengaging properly.
Can a faulty turn signal relay cause the signal to stay on?
Yes, a defective relay can cause the turn signal to remain illuminated. The relay controls the blinking function, and if it becomes stuck in the closed position, the signal will not turn off as intended.
Is it dangerous to drive with a turn signal that won’t turn off?
Driving with an active turn signal can confuse other drivers and increase the risk of accidents. It is advisable to address the issue promptly to maintain safe and predictable vehicle signaling.
How can I troubleshoot a turn signal that won’t turn off?
Start by checking the turn signal switch for mechanical faults or debris. Inspect the relay and fuses for damage or corrosion. If necessary, use a multimeter to test for electrical continuity and shorts in the wiring.
Can a blown fuse cause the turn signal to stay on?
A blown fuse typically disables the turn signal rather than causing it to stay on. However, a partially damaged fuse or related wiring issues could contribute to erratic turn signal behavior.
